Dynamics 365 CRM Solutions Architect

Job Title: Dynamics Solutions Architect - Microsoft Technology Services

Location: UK - Hybrid Working

Salary: Up to £90,000 | No sponsorship available

Overview: We are working with a leading professional services firm seeking a Dynamics Solutions Architect to help clients transform their business capabilities using Microsoft Dynamics 365. This role offers the opportunity to work on high-profile CRM and enterprise transformation projects across diverse industries, delivering measurable impact and shaping the future of clients' technology strategies.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ead discovery workshops to understand client goals, challenges, and requirements across CRM, data, integration, and compliance domains.

  • Design technical solutions and advise on enterprise CRM roadmaps to maximise business value.

  • Oversee and guide the delivery of Dynamics 365 solutions, ensuring high quality and alignment with client needs.

  • Contribute to thought leadership, proposals, and innovation initiatives in the Dynamics space.

  • Collaborate with diverse teams, fostering an inclusive culture where contributions are recognised and valued.

Required Experience and Skills:

  • Strong expertise in Microsoft Dynamics 365 CE/CRM, with experience delivering solutions in a business context.

  • Knowledge of the wider Microsoft ecosystem including Azure, Power Platform, M365, and Active Directory.

  • Advanced Microsoft Dynamics 365 CE/CRM functional certification (e.g., Marketing, Sales, Customer Service Functional Consultant Associate).

  • Experience leading workshops, defining system strategy, testing, training, and supporting implementations.

  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to translate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.

  • Experience contributing to RFPs and business development activities.

  • Previous experience as a Technical Consultant or Architect within Microsoft Dynamics 365 CE/CRM.

Desirable Experience:

  • Industry experience in Public Sector, Financial Services, Energy, Consumer Goods, Retail, Manufacturing, Life Sciences, Telecoms, Media, or Technology.

  • Familiarity with Microsoft AI capabilities such as Dynamics 365 Copilot, Nuance, or OpenAI Service Builder.

  • Experience in Field Service, HR, Finance & Operations, or equivalent.

  • Knowledge of Agile/Scrum methodology, process mapping, and end-user training material development.
